What is hcmo_3rd.tsp doing on my computer?

hcmo_3rd.tsp is a module belonging to HiPath TAPI 120//170 V2.0 TAPI 2.2 Service Provider from Siemens AG - ICN EN HS D 63 Witten.
Non-system processes like hcmo_3rd.tsp originate from software you installed on your system. Is hcmo_3rd.tsp harmful?

hcmo_3rd.tsp has not been assigned a security rating yet. The hcmo_3rd.tsp file should be located in the folder C:\Windows\System32. Otherwise it could be a Trojan.

Can I stop or remove hcmo_3rd.tsp?

Many non-system processes that are running can be stopped because they are not involved in running your operating system. hcmo_3rd.tsp is used by 'HiPath TAPI 120//170 V2.0 TAPI 2.2 Service Provider'. This is an application created by 'Siemens AG - ICN EN HS D 63 Witten'.

If you no longer use HiPath TAPI 120//170 V2.0 TAPI 2.2 Service Provider, you can permanently remove this software and thus hcmo_3rd.tsp from your PC. To do this, press the Windows key + R at the same time and then type 'appwiz.cpl'. Then find HiPath TAPI 120//170 V2.0 TAPI 2.2 Service Provider in the list of installed programs and uninstall this application.
